#d89108 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d89108 is composed of 84.7% red, 56.9% green and 3.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 32.9% magenta, 96.3% yellow and 15.3% black. It has a hue angle of 39.5 degrees, a saturation of 92.9% and a lightness of 43.9%. #d89108 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ff10 with #b12300. Closest websafe color is: #cc9900.

#d89108 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d89108 has RGB values of R:216, G:145, B:8 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.33, Y:0.96, K:0.15. Its decimal value is 14192904.

Shades and Tints of #d89108
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080500 is the darkest color, while #fffbf4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d89108
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#71706f is the less saturated color, while #d89108 is the most saturated one.
